Embark on a Divine Epicurean Odyssey: "Seafood Loves Sake. 2024" Returns for its 4th Unforgettable Gourmet Affair

A Gastronomic Symphony Orchestrated by JFOODO in Joint with 16 Handpicked Restaurants in Singapore, Unveiling an Unparalleled Wine and Culinary Extravaganza

SINGAPORE - Media OutReach Newswire - 19 January 2024 - The Japan Food Product Overseas Promotion Center ("JFOODO"), in collaboration with 16 renowned restaurants throughout Singapore, is thrilled to announce the return of the highly anticipated "Seafood Loves Sake.
2024" gourmet festival (the "Campaign") for its 4th edition. This time-determined event will showcase 32 sets of exquisite pairs of seafood and sake, offering a unique savoury experience for food and wine enthusiasts. The Campaign will be divided into two phases, allowing patrons ample opportunity to indulge in this gastronomic delight. The first phase will run from 20th January to 8th February 2024, featuring thirteen participating restaurants. The second phase will take place from 26th February to 17th March 2024, with three additional restaurants offering their picked creations.

he Perfect Harmony: "Seafood Loves Sake. 2024" Presents Synergistic Flavours and Elaborated Enhancements

Seafood Loves Sake. 2024 identifies how the marriage of delicate seafood flavours with the elegant profiles of sake results in a true gastronomic delight, highlighting their synergistic flavours. Japanese sake, a traditional alcoholic beverage made from rice, koji (rice malt), and water, plays a central role in this Campaign. Brewed through a meticulous process, sake offers diverse flavours, ranging from light and mild to bold and rich. When paired with seafood, sake creates a new dimension of outstanding taste through the synergy of sapor. The Campaign introduces the different types of sake, including aromatic, smooth and refreshing, rich with umami, aged with a nutty fragrance, and the emerging naturally sparkling varieties. Each class offers a unique sensory experience, enriching the pairing with seafood.

Sake's Remarkable "Supplemental Effect" Beyond Elevating Harmonious Flavors

Unlike white wine, which might intensify seafood's unpleasant smell. As a fermented liquor, sake enhances the umami of foods and neutralises the undesirable odours that may arise from seafood, ensuring that only delicious flavours prevail. A survey conducted in Japan revealed that approximately 70% of people enjoy sake as their primary alcoholic beverage during meals.

JFOODO

JFOODO, which stands for The Japan Food Product Overseas Promotion Center, was established in 2017 by the Japanese government as part of the Japan External Trade Organization (JETRO). JFOODO collaborates with industry partners to showcase the quality, diversity, and authenticity of Japanese food and beverages through various campaigns and events. The mission is to enhance the export of Japanese agricultural, forestry, fishery, and food products and to brand and promote these products globally.

In Japanese, culture can be expressed as 「風土」(pronounced as "fudo"), which coincidentally rhymes with "JFOODO." The name also reflects their aspiration to increase worldwide recognition and appreciation for Japanese food, akin to how other aspects of Japanese culture have gained international acclaim. In Japanese, the kanji character「道」(read as "dō") symbolises "the way" or "the code." JFOODO strives to embrace and promote "the way of food" alongside Japanese culture to captivate global audiences and cultivate a deep appreciation for Japanese food and its rich heritage.
